Episode Synopsis

In this episode we look at why more asylum seekers are crossing into Canada at irregular border crossings? Is the new Trump administration policies and clamp down at the southern border affecting the numbers coming to Canada?  And do the customs and border agents have enough resources to do their job?

Guests: Jean-Pierre Fortin, National President Customs and Immigration Union; Bill Blair, Minister for Border Security and Protection and Organized Crime Reduction; Todd Smith, Ontario Social Services Minister
